When was CRAIG HAMILTON ARCHITECTS LIMITED founded?
CRAIG HAMILTON ARCHITECTS LIMITED was officially incorporated on 27 August 2003 and is registered under company number 04878642. Incorporation establishes the company as a legal entity registered at Companies House, allowing it to trade, enter contracts, and operate under UK company law.

Is CRAIG HAMILTON ARCHITECTS LIMITED financially stable?
The most recent accounts for CRAIG HAMILTON ARCHITECTS LIMITED were made up to 30 September 2024, filed as TOTAL EXEMPTION FULL. Next accounts are due by 30 June 2026.
Does CRAIG HAMILTON ARCHITECTS LIMITED have any charges or mortgages?
CRAIG HAMILTON ARCHITECTS LIMITED has 2 registered charges, of which 2 are outstanding, 0 satisfied, and 0 part satisfied. Charges are typically registered when a company uses its assets as security for borrowing.
